Description
A delightful treat combining creamy brie cheese, tangy cranberry sauce, and crunchy pecans in flaky puff pastry.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 sheet of puff pastry
- 1 wheel of brie cheese
- 1/2 cup of cranberry sauce
- 1/2 cup of pecans, chopped
- 1 egg (for egg wash)
- Crackers or bread for serving
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Roll out the puff pastry on a floured surface and place the brie cheese in the center.
- Spread the cranberry sauce over the brie and sprinkle with chopped pecans.
- Fold the pastry over the cheese to enclose it completely, sealing the edges.
- Brush the top with beaten egg for a golden finish.
- Place on a ba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until golden brown.
- Let cool slightly before serving with crackers or bread.
Notes
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2-3 days. Reheat in the oven to regain texture.
